Histamine is a key intermediary for instant hypersensitivity reactions that act locally and assist with vasodilatation, smooth muscle contraction, high vascular permeability, inflammation, and edema. Antihistamines are representative of a class of drugs that inhibit the receptors of histamine type 1 (H1). H1 receptor is present on smooth bronchial muscle, gastrointestinal tract, uterus, and large blood vessels. The major application of antihistamines has been observed in the treatment of symptoms such as allergic conditions including itching, runny nose, nasal stuffiness, hives, teary eyes, dizziness, cough, and nausea. Sedation, impaired motor function, dry mouth & throat, dizziness, blurred vision, constipation, and urinary retention are some common side effects observed due to antihistamines treatment. However, modern drug development technologies have helped to reduce the aforementioned side effects of antihistamines since a few decades.

The two classes of antihistamines are antihistamines of the first generation and second generation. First-generation antihistamines include drugs such as alimemazine, clemastine, chlorphenamine, hydroxyzine, cyproheptadine, ketotifen, promethazine, and others. Drugs like cetirizine, acrivastine, desloratadine, levocetirizine, fexofenadine, and loratadine. In 2017, the segment of second-generation antihistamines was observed as the largest market as they are used as the first line of action in diseases such as urticaria & common cold, and modern drug development technologies have helped to enhance the activity of second-generation antihistamines e.g.: cetirizine was developed to reduce dizziness caused by cetirizine. There are several antihistamine applications such as allergic rhinitis, conjunctivitis, urticaria, atopic dermatitis, anaphylaxis, and others (angioedema, pruritus, and others). Allergic rhinitis and urticaria together accounted for more than 50 percent of the market share in 2017 due to the highest global prevalence of disease coupled with increased awareness and accessibility related to disease diagnosis and treatment. According to the American Academy of Allergy Asthma & Immunology (AAAAI), globally allergic rhinitis affects about 10 percent to 30 percent of the population each year. Thus, disease prevalence determines the market demand for antihistamines.
